Декодер – это устройство или программа, способное преобразовывать данные из одной формы в другую. Это неотъемлемая часть многих технических систем, языков программирования и сетевых протоколов. Декодеры широко используются для обработки информации, не только в аппаратных устройствах, но и в программном обеспечении.
Принцип работы декодера заключается в преобразовании входной информации с использованием заданных правил или алгоритмов. Входные данные, которые могут быть в виде цифрового сигнала, символов, кодов и т.д., подвергаются процессу декодирования, что приводит к получению выходной информации в нужной форме. В зависимости от конкретной задачи и вида декодера, преобразование может происходить путем сопоставления с заданным набором правил или с использованием таблицы соответствий.
Существует множество различных видов декодеров, каждый из которых предназначен для определенного типа входных данных. Например, существуют текстовые декодеры, используемые для преобразования кодировок символов, звуковые декодеры, используемые для расшифровки звуковых файлов, и видео декодеры, используемые для преобразования видеоданных в понятный формат. Кроме того, существуют декодеры, способные обрабатывать сжатые данные, такие как аудио- и видеокодеки.
Декодеры имеют широкое применение в различных областях, включая телекоммуникации, информационные технологии, электронику, программирование и другие. Они позволяют обрабатывать и понимать различные виды информации, что значительно упрощает работу с данными и повышает эффективность работы системы в целом.
Декодер: принцип работы, виды и применение
Декодер – это электронное устройство, которое преобразует закодированный сигнал в исходную информацию. Принцип работы декодера основан на распознавании и приведении закодированных символов к их исходному виду. Декодеры широко применяются в сфере электроники, телекоммуникаций и информационных технологий.
Основным принципом работы декодера является сопоставление закодированного символа с его исходным значением. Закодированный сигнал поступает на вход декодера, где происходит его обработка и преобразование. Декодер может быть реализован как с помощью комбинационных логических схем, так и с использованием микроконтроллеров или программного обеспечения.
Существует несколько видов декодеров в зависимости от их функциональности и способа преобразования закодированного сигнала. Одним из наиболее распространенных видов декодеров является двоичный декодер. Он преобразует двоичные числа в несколько выходов, исходя из значения входных сигналов. Двоичные декодеры находят применение в области адресации памяти, управления периферийными устройствами и протоколах коммуникации.
Другим типом декодеров являются дешифраторы, которые преобразуют закодированный сигнал в десятичное число или в набор выходных сигналов. Дешифраторы широко применяются в цифровых схемах и дисплеях, где необходимо отобразить числовую или символьную информацию.
Одним из сложных видов декодеров являются видеодекодеры. Они выполняют декодирование видеосигнала, полученного из источника данных, и преобразуют его в видеоформат, который может быть отображен на экране. Видеодекодеры применяются в телевизорах, мультимедийных плеерах, видеокамерах и других устройствах, работающих с видеоинформацией.
Декодеры также используются в системах безопасности, где распознают и декодируют информацию, поступающую с различных сенсоров и камер. Они играют важную роль в автомобильной промышленности, позволяя считывать и интерпретировать данные с автомобильных датчиков и передавать их на приборную панель.
В заключение, декодер – это устройство, которое имеет широкий спектр применений и играет важную роль в области электроники и телекоммуникаций. Он обеспечивает преобразование закодированных сигналов в понятную информацию, что делает его незаменимым компонентом в современных технологиях.
Декодер: определение и принцип работы
Декодер – это электронное устройство, которое преобразует информацию из одной формы в другую. Он выполняет обратную функцию кодера или энкодера, который, наоборот, преобразует информацию в форму, которая легко передается или хранится.
Принцип работы декодера заключается в том, что он получает входной сигнал в кодированной форме и преобразует его обратно в исходную форму информации. Декодер может использовать различные алгоритмы или таблицы для выполнения этой операции.
Наиболее распространенные виды декодеров включают в себя:
- Двоичный декодер: он преобразует входные двоичные коды в соответствующие выходные сигналы. Двоичный декодер может иметь различное количество входов и выходов в зависимости от своего предназначения.
- Дешифратор: используется для преобразования входного сигнала в один из нескольких выходных сигналов, в зависимости от кодировки включенного входа.
- Адресный декодер: преобразует адрес в памяти компьютера в специальный код, который активирует соответствующий модуль или устройство. Он используется в цифровых системах для выбора нужного устройства и передачи ему информации.
Декодеры широко применяются в различных областях, включая электронику, компьютерные системы, телекоммуникации и автоматизацию производства. Они позволяют эффективно передавать и интерпретировать информацию, обеспечивая правильное взаимодействие компонентов системы.
Виды декодеров и их особенности
Декодер – это электронное устройство, которое преобразует кодированный сигнал в набор выходных сигналов по заданной схеме. Существует несколько основных видов декодеров, каждый из которых имеет свои особенности и применение.
Двоичный декодер: такой декодер используется для декодирования двоичного кода. Он имеет несколько входов и несколько выходов, причем только один из выходов может быть активным в каждый момент времени. Двоичный декодер может иметь различное количество входов и выходов в зависимости от его конфигурации. Обычно он используется в цифровых схемах, где необходимо декодировать определенные комбинации двоичных сигналов.
Приоритетный декодер: этот тип декодера осуществляет приоритетное декодирование входного кода. Он имеет несколько входов и несколько выходов, причем активным может быть только выход с наибольшим приоритетом. Если несколько входов активны одновременно, то выход с наибольшим приоритетом будет активным. Приоритетный декодер обычно используется в системах с множеством задач, где необходимо обработать разные комбинации сигналов с разной степенью важности.
Потенциометрический декодер: это особый вид декодера, который используется для преобразования аналогового сигнала в цифровой. Он состоит из потенциометра и определенного набора резисторов. Основная особенность этого декодера заключается в наличии бесконечного числа выходных значений в зависимости от положения потенциометра. Потенциометрические декодеры широко используются в аудиоустройствах для регулирования громкости или тона.
BCD-декодер: такой декодер преобразует двоично-десятичный код (BCD) в десятичный формат. Он имеет четыре входа и десять выходов, каждый из которых соответствует одной цифре от 0 до 9. BCD-декодеры часто используются в цифровых схемах, связанных с отображением чисел на семисегментных дисплеях.
Каждый из этих видов декодеров имеет свои преимущества и особенности, позволяющие использовать их в различных областях электроники и вычислительной техники.
Применение декодеров в современных технологиях
Декодеры играют важную роль в современных технологиях, обеспечивая конвертацию различных типов данных и сигналов в понятный и удобный для чтения формат.
1. Видео и аудио кодеки:
- Декодеры используются в видео и аудио кодеках для распаковки сжатого медиа-контента (видео и аудио файлов).
- Они преобразуют сжатые данные в оригинальный формат, позволяя воспроизвести видео или аудио сигнал.
- Популярные форматы видео и аудио, поддерживаемые декодерами, включают MP3, H.264, MPEG-4, AAC и другие.
2. Компьютерные сети:
- Декодеры используются в сетевых устройствах, таких как маршрутизаторы и коммутаторы, для преобразования сигналов и обработки информации.
- Они могут декодировать различные протоколы передачи данных, такие как Ethernet, TCP/IP, UDP и другие, чтобы обеспечить правильную коммуникацию между устройствами.
- Декодеры также могут использоваться для расшифровки зашифрованных данных в сетях, обеспечивая безопасность и конфиденциальность передачи информации.
3. Кодирование и декодирование информации:
- Декодеры играют важную роль в обработке и понимании сложной информации, закодированной в определенных форматах.
- Они могут декодировать данные из форматов, таких как Base64, URL-кодировка, JSON и других, чтобы обеспечить их понятность для приложений и устройств.
- Декодеры также могут применяться для расшифровки зашифрованных сообщений или файлов, обеспечивая доступ к содержимому.
4. Игровая индустрия:
- Декодеры используются в игровых системах для декодирования физических и логических сигналов, связанных с управлением и взаимодействием игроков.
- Они позволяют интерпретировать действия игрока, преобразуя их в соответствующие команды в игровом движке.
- Декодеры также могут использоваться для декодирования графических моделей и анимаций, обеспечивая реалистичность и увлекательность игрового процесса.
Применение декодеров в современных технологиях очень разнообразно и охватывает множество областей, от медиа-контента до сетевых коммуникаций и игровой индустрии. Благодаря использованию декодеров, мы можем получать и обрабатывать информацию в удобном и понятном формате, что существенно облегчает нашу повседневную жизнь.
Вопрос-ответ
Декодер: что это такое?
Декодер — это устройство или программа, предназначенные для преобразования закодированной информации в исходный вид. Он может принимать данные в одном формате и декодировать их в другой, делая их понятными для пользователя.
Как работает декодер?
Декодер работает путем принятия закодированных данных и их преобразования в исходный вид. Он может использовать различные алгоритмы и методы для декодирования данных, в зависимости от типа кодировки. Например, в случае аудио-декодера, он может принять сигналы сжатого аудио и декодировать их в исходный аудиофайл.
Какие виды декодеров существуют?
Существует несколько видов декодеров в зависимости от типа кодировки, которую они декодируют. Некоторые из них включают аудио-декодеры, видео-декодеры, текстовые декодеры и изображения декодеры. Каждый из этих видов декодеров специализируется на декодировании конкретных типов данных.